Plant ecology is a branch of ecology, which is concerned with the study of the abundance and distribution of plants, the effect of environmental factors and the interactions between plants and other organisms. The plant kingdom ranges in complexity from the single-celled algae to large canopy forming trees. Plant communities are distributed into biomes depending on the dominant plant species present. Some of the important vegetation types are tundra, terrestrial wetlands, temperate grasslands, tropical forests, tropical savannas, etc. The predominant biological interactions occurring in plant communities are competition for resources, mutualism and herbivory. Depending on the level of organization, plant ecology can be divided into plant ecophysiology, community ecology, ecosystem ecology and biosphere ecology, among others.
